| ########################################################################### |
| # Public functions to be used in the manifest |
| |
| |
| def include(manifest): |
| """Include another manifest. |
| |
| The manifest argument can be a string (filename) or an iterable of |
| strings. |
| |
| Relative paths are resolved with respect to the current manifest file. |
| """ |
| |
| if not isinstance(manifest, str): |
| for m in manifest: |
| include(m) |
| else: |
| manifest = convert_path(manifest) |
| with open(manifest) as f: |
| # Make paths relative to this manifest file while processing it. |
| # Applies to includes and input files. |
| prev_cwd = os.getcwd() |
| os.chdir(os.path.dirname(manifest)) |
| exec(f.read()) |
| os.chdir(prev_cwd) |
| |
| |
| def freeze(path, script=None, opt=0): |
| """Freeze the input, automatically determining its type. A .py script |
| will be compiled to a .mpy first then frozen, and a .mpy file will be |
| frozen directly. |
| |
| `path` must be a directory, which is the base directory to search for |
| files from. When importing the resulting frozen modules, the name of |
| the module will start after `path`, ie `path` is excluded from the |
| module name. |
| |
| If `path` is relative, it is resolved to the current manifest.py. |
| Use $(MPY_DIR), $(MPY_LIB_DIR), $(PORT_DIR), $(BOARD_DIR) if you need |
| to access specific paths. |
| |
| If `script` is None all files in `path` will be frozen. |
| |
| If `script` is an iterable then freeze() is called on all items of the |
| iterable (with the same `path` and `opt` passed through). |
| |
| If `script` is a string then it specifies the filename to freeze, and |
| can include extra directories before the file. The file will be |
| searched for in `path`. |
| |
| `opt` is the optimisation level to pass to mpy-cross when compiling .py |
| to .mpy. |
| """ |
| |
| freeze_internal(KIND_AUTO, path, script, opt) |
| |
| |
| def freeze_as_str(path): |
| """Freeze the given `path` and all .py scripts within it as a string, |
| which will be compiled upon import. |
| """ |
| |
| freeze_internal(KIND_AS_STR, path, None, 0) |
| |
| |
| def freeze_as_mpy(path, script=None, opt=0): |
| """Freeze the input (see above) by first compiling the .py scripts to |
| .mpy files, then freezing the resulting .mpy files. |
| """ |
| |
| freeze_internal(KIND_AS_MPY, path, script, opt) |
| |
| |
| def freeze_mpy(path, script=None, opt=0): |
| """Freeze the input (see above), which must be .mpy files that are |
| frozen directly. |
| """ |
| |
| freeze_internal(KIND_MPY, path, script, opt) |
| |
